If high-energy breed training stalls, check basics first: motivation, timing of rewards, and whether the environment is too hard too soon.

Practical tips

For High-Energy Breed Training, keep criteria clear and celebrate small wins.

  • Say the cue once; repeating teaches your dog to wait for a louder version.
  • Reward the instant the behavior happens, not after your dog walks away.
  • If progress stalls, simplify the step before adding distractions.
  • Short daily reps beat one long session for high-energy breed training.
